
Overcoming Anxiety: A Young Woman's Journey Starting Her Dream Job in Bangalore

A 23-year-old woman recently moved to Bangalore to pursue her dream job, which came with an impressive salary package that was double what she had anticipated. Initially, her transition seemed to be smooth and exciting, as she arrived a week early to acclimate to her new environment. She enjoyed her time exploring the city, relishing the supportive atmosphere at her new workplace, and bonding with her kind colleagues. However, upon officially starting her job, she began to experience severe anxiety and panic attacks, leading her to question why such a seemingly perfect situation felt so overwhelming. Despite the positive aspects of her new role, including a structured work environment and enjoyable office amenities, she found herself crying frequently and struggling to cope with the emotional turmoil. The stark contrast between her expectations and her reality left her feeling isolated and confused. She often found herself in the bathroom stall, calling her parents and partner for comfort, grappling with the question, "Why is this happening to me?" This highlights a significant yet often overlooked truth: even positive changes can trigger emotional distress. The young woman acknowledged that she had previously worked in a similar corporate culture in her hometown, which made her current feelings even more perplexing. The only major difference was the full-time commitment required in Bangalore, as opposed to her previous hybrid work arrangement. This realization underscores the complexity of adjusting to new circumstances, regardless of their apparent benefits. As she navigates this challenging transition, she contemplates small steps, such as inviting her mother to stay with her for support, indicating the importance of seeking help during difficult times.
